‘He is my idol and unbelievable father’ – Andre Ayew on Abedi Pele

Black Stars captain, Andre Ayew has described his father, Abedi Pele as his ‘idol’.

Pele is regarded as one of the most successful Ghanaian footballers of all time following his exploits with Ghana and at club level.

He made 73 appearance for the Black Stars and scored 19 goals.

The former Olympique Marseille star won the UEFA Champions League with the club in 1992/93 season.

“I take a lot if not every inspiration from him. He is my idol and an unbelievable father,” Andre Ayew said on Gtv sports plus.

The former Swansea City play maker joined Al Sadd in Qatar last year, a club his dad played for in 1982/83 football season.

Ayew is expected to lead the Black Stars of Ghana to the FIFA World Cup in Qatar coming November
